Onboarding note for the Ledgerpane admin table: bulk edits are applied through the batcher service, not directly against the database. Select rows, choose an action, and the batcher stages changes in a pending set you can review before commit. Edits over 500 rows require a second approver — this is enforced server-side, so don't try to chunk around it. To run the batcher locally you need the staging write credential, which goes in your .env as the next line.

secret setting of bahip-kagag: RELAY_SECRET3=c83

Ticket: Staging env misconfigured for Siftgate bloom filter

The bloom layer in front of the Pellet KV store is rejecting all lookups in staging because the env file was copied from the dev template without credentials. False-positive tuning values are fine; only the auth line is missing. To unblock the weekly demo, the Pellet admission secret must be set on the following line.

env line for yaguf-fajop: LEDGER_TOKEN13=fb08984397349

**Release checklist — Textgrove upload pipeline.** Confirm the encoding sniffer correctly classifies uploaded text files before they reach the parser. Previous releases misread UTF-16 files without byte-order marks as Latin-1, which let crafted payloads slip past the sanitizer unexamined — a genuine security concern, not just a display bug. Run the full encoding corpus, including the adversarial samples from the Marroway audit, and confirm zero misclassifications. The corpus runner prints the verification token to record just below this entry.

pipeline stamp: htk31_f769b577b3028a4e9958e5bb8d1259a